Konica Minolta Sensing Americas, Inc. (KMSA) is a leading provider of advanced light, color, and display measurement solutions, supporting customers across highly technical and innovative industries. Our teams work in a collaborative, hands-on environment where precision, quality, consistency, and problem-solving are essential to delivering dependable measurement solutions.
We are seeking a Calibration Technician to support the accuracy, quality, and reliability of KMSA products through hands-on calibration, testing, inspection, and technical analysis. This role is responsible for performing established calibration and testing procedures, evaluating product performance, documenting results, and helping identify issues that may affect product quality or reliability. The Calibration Technician will work closely with cross-functional teams to support troubleshooting, resolve technical concerns, and contribute to continuous improvement within the calibration and production environment.
The ideal candidate will bring solid hands-on technical experience, strong attention to detail, and the ability to perform routine and moderately complex calibration and testing activities with a growing level of independence. Success in this role requires a methodical approach to work, comfort with technical equipment and documented procedures, sound judgment when identifying irregularities, and a willingness to collaborate with others to ensure products consistently meet established quality and performance standards.
This position is 100 percent onsite and requires daily presence at KMSA’s Redmond headquarters to support calibration, testing, production, and other lab-based activities.

About Konica Minolta Sensing Americas
Konica Minolta Sensing Americas, Inc. works with leading brands, manufacturers, and research organizations to provide advanced measurement solutions that support product quality, consistency, innovation, and performance. With decades of expertise in color, light, display, and appearance measurement, KMSA serves a wide range of industries, including automotive, aerospace, electronics, lighting, consumer products, and manufacturing.
KMSA offers a broad portfolio of precision instruments and software solutions designed to help customers evaluate color, brightness, light, display performance, and visual quality. Our technologies enable organizations to improve quality control, strengthen manufacturing processes, reduce variation, and deliver products that meet demanding performance and appearance standards.
